The Chicago Hotel Collection - Millennium Park Suites and Extended Stay

The Chicago Hotel Collection - Millennium Park is located in The Loop, a neighborhood in Chicago, and is in the city center and near the beach. Chicago Cultural Center and Harris Theater are cultural highlights, and some of the area's attractions include Skydeck Ledge and Chicago Children's Museum. Looking to enjoy an event or a game while in town? See what's happening at Soldier Field or UIC Pavilion. Guests love the property's central location. A restaurant, a coffee shop/café, and laundry facilities are available at this smoke-free aparthotel. WiFi in public areas is free. Other amenities include express check-in and express check-out. Each apartment provides an LCD TV with satellite channels, plus a kitchen with a refrigerator, an oven, and a stovetop. Added amenities include free WiFi, a living room, and a coffee/tea maker. The bathroom is shared. The Chicago Hotel Collection - Millennium Park offers 100 accommodations with coffee/tea makers and hair dryers. These individually furnished accommodations have separate living rooms. Kitchens offer full-sized refrigerators/freezers, stovetops, and cookware/dishes/utensils. Guests have access to shared bathrooms. This Chicago aparthotel provides complimentary wireless Internet access. LCD televisions come with satellite channels. Additionally, rooms include irons/ironing boards and complimentary toiletries.

“The place is very good located but I never though that this kind of lodging could be found in hotels.com (it is more likely an Airbnb). There a couple of things that you could keep in mind. The reception hours is just form 11:00 am to 9:00 pm and not 10 amto 11 pm as they say on their advice. After hours there is a phone number that nobody takes care of it (the locution says that they are open form 10 to 10 but none answer it. The surveillance people are great but they do not have answer for the most common questions like parking, WiFi or towels and sheets. The units are quite old, dirty and the paint is quite damage. Good place if you are planning to stay close to the Millennium Park and you do just need the room for sleeping. About the valet parking, be ready for a time limitation. You can take your car in/out between 9 am to 6pm.”
— Guillermo Chicote
“Before I came here I was quite nervous after reading the reviews as there was no cancellation policy. Honestly I don't know why people are so down on this place, yeah it's old, but its got history it's a cool building, especially the lobby, it has character it's a little rough round the edges, but if you want the ritz carlton, go stay there and pay their prices. It's not cheap, nothing is in Chicago with all their taxes, buy it's not an outrageous price either. I got an inner room its reasonably quiet , but if you want quiet dont stay in downtown, its very warm, and clean, and the location is brilliant . I would stay here again.”
— Matthew Saywell
